Understanding Metal Grades and Quality Assurance
Quality is the currency of the scrap world. When you purchase metal, you are not just buying weight; you are buying specific chemical compositions. Ferrous metals, such as steel and iron, are graded based on their density, size, and level of impurities. Non-ferrous metals, including copper, aluminium, lead, and zinc, command much higher prices and require rigorous testing to ensure they meet industry standards. A scrap buyer must be proficient in identifying these grades. For example, ‘Bright and Shiny’ copper wire is graded significantly higher than ‘Burnt’ or ‘Insulated’ copper due to the processing costs involved in refining. When you buy scrap, you must account for the ‘yield’—the percentage of usable metal you will actually extract after processing. Contamination, such as plastic insulation on copper or oil residue on aluminium, can drastically reduce your margins. Trusted dealers provide certificates of analysis for larger shipments, which is a standard practice for high-value non-ferrous transactions. Always perform a physical inspection or request a third-party audit if you are sourcing from unknown suppliers. The goal is to minimize ‘down-grading’ at the smelting stage, which is where many inexperienced traders lose significant capital.
The Recycling Process: From Yard to Smelter
The journey of scrap metal from a demolition site to a finished product is a sophisticated industrial process. Once a metal buyer acquires scrap, it undergoes a series of transformations. First, the material is weighed and inspected for hazardous substances, such as lead-acid batteries or radioactive components, which are strictly prohibited. The scrap is then sorted using advanced optical sorters, X-ray fluorescence (XRF) analyzers, and electromagnetic separators. This level of precision is why professional scrap trading services are vital for maintaining the purity of the recycling stream. After sorting, the metal is processed through a shredder or shear. Shredding reduces the metal into small, uniform pieces, while shearing cuts larger structural components into manageable sizes. These pieces are then compacted into dense bales or briquettes to optimize transport logistics. Finally, the scrap is shipped to a foundry or smelter, where it is melted down, alloyed, and cast into new ingots, rods, or sheets. This process consumes significantly less energy than extracting virgin ore from the earth, making it a cornerstone of the global move toward carbon neutrality. Environmental Benefits and Regulatory Compliance
The environmental impact of recycling scrap metal cannot be overstated. Recycling aluminium, for instance, requires 95% less energy than producing it from bauxite ore. Similarly, recycling steel saves approximately 75% of the energy needed for virgin steel production. When you understand the environmental benefits, you can better position your business as a leader in sustainable procurement. In Australia, the industry is heavily governed by the National Environment Protection Measures (NEPM) and state-based environmental protection authorities. As a buyer, you have a duty of care to ensure that the scrap you purchase has been handled in accordance with these regulations. This means sourcing only from facilities that utilize proper water filtration, dust suppression, and hazardous waste management systems. Engaging with trusted dealers who are ISO-certified ensures that your supply chain is not only profitable but also legally and ethically sound. Many modern corporations now require ‘green’ procurement reports, and by documenting your scrap sourcing, you add significant value to your company’s ESG (Environmental, Social, and Governance) profile.

Practical Tips for Successful Procurement
Successful procurement in the scrap industry relies on three pillars: logistics, relationships, and technical knowledge. First, logistics: transport costs can easily erode your profits. Always factor in the cost of freight, especially when dealing with low-density scrap like light steel. If possible, consolidate your shipments to maximize container utilization. Second, relationships: the scrap industry is built on trust. A scrap buyer who pays on time and communicates clearly will always get first access to the best inventory from suppliers. Visit the yards you buy from; seeing the operation firsthand provides insights that a phone call never will. Third, technical knowledge: invest in basic testing equipment, such as a handheld XRF analyzer, if you are trading in non-ferrous metals. This allows you to verify the grade of the material on the spot, preventing disputes and ensuring you get what you pay for. Finally, keep a close watch on the Scrap Metal Prices index, as this will help you time your purchases effectively. Remember, the market is cyclical; buying during periods of low industrial activity can often lead to significant gains when demand spikes. Always document every transaction, maintain clear records of the material grade, and ensure all paperwork complies with the relevant state regulations to protect your business from future liabilities.

Frequently Asked Questions
How do I verify if a scrap dealer is trustworthy?
Look for businesses that hold valid environmental licenses, have a physical yard you can visit, and provide transparent pricing based on current market rates. Check for industry memberships and positive reviews from other industrial clients.
What is the difference between ferrous and non-ferrous scrap?
Ferrous metals contain iron, such as steel and cast iron, and are magnetic. Non-ferrous metals, such as copper, aluminium, and brass, do not contain iron, are non-magnetic, and generally command higher prices due to their scarcity and recycling value.
How do scrap metal prices change?
Prices are driven by global supply and demand, the cost of energy, and the current LME (London Metal Exchange) commodity rates. Local factors like transport costs and the availability of specific metal grades also influence the final price you pay.
What documentation is required when buying scrap metal?
You should always receive a weighbridge ticket, a tax invoice, and, for larger or specialized loads, a certificate of analysis or a declaration of origin. These documents are essential for tax purposes and environmental compliance audits.
